The cheapest way to get from Stirling to Crinan is to bus which costs £23 - £35 and takes 5h 21m.
The fastest way to get from Stirling to Crinan is to drive which takes 2h 7m and costs £24 - £40.
No, there is no direct bus from Stirling station to Crinan. However, there are services departing from Bus Station and arriving at Canal Basin via Buchanan Bus Station and Argyll Arms Hotel.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 21m.
The distance between Stirling and Crinan is 120 miles. The road distance is 101.6 miles.
The best way to get from Stirling to Crinan without a car is to bus which takes 5h 21m and costs £23 - £35.
It takes approximately 5h 21m to get from Stirling to Crinan, including transfers.
